**Action Item 2: Fix turnstile counter drift**

The Ridgemoor Arena counters undercounted entries during the gate surge because the Gatewatch aggregator dropped events when its buffer filled. Add buffer-depth alerting and a reconciliation job against the scanner logs. Owner: on-call rotation. The alert thresholds and reconciliation procedure are documented on the internal page below.

operations page: https://jira.qorvelsys.internal/browse/pages/browse/pages

// Mitigation constant for the Larkfield query planner regression.
// Planner v41 misestimates cardinality on composite indexes when the
// leading column is low-selectivity, producing full scans on the orders
// partition. This constant forces the legacy cost model until the fix
// ships. Do NOT remove without confirming planner v42 is live on all
// shards — check the Larkfield ops dashboard first. If paged on scan
// storms, verify this flag is still set. The reference build is
// pinned below.

session token of bawep-yadup = htk21_528abd376e3c5a4ec24a1

## Releases

Version 4.2 of Keyhaven ships the revamped password reset flow: single-use tokens, shortened expiry, and rate limiting at the edge. Before promoting the build, confirm the migration for token tables completed on staging. Every release artifact must carry a valid signature. Verify each artifact against the release key below.

deploy key for kajof-fajop: bky6_gDHw9Q